An enjoyable romance that also aims for social satire and lightly plumbs questions of technology, fate and free will. I found the satire (of the tech startup/VC world, over the top women's health industry, general consumerism) amusing, but paring it and the book length overall would have helped. I did enjoy the fully fleshed main characters, and their inner relationship monologues certainly rang true!
